titleOfInvention | Lapping compound and method for using same |
abstract | A lapping compound including an abrasive, a detergent and a carrier. The lapping compound is mixed with a lubricating agent and applied to a workpiece surface. The most preferred abrasives are silica for softer metals, and a combination of silica and garnet for harder metals. The preferred detergents are oil based sulfonates, and more preferably sodium dodecylbenzenesulfonate. The preferred carrier is selected from the group consisting of barium sulfate and the barium soaps of fatty acids, the barium soaps having a solubility factor in water of not more than 0.008 grams per cubic centimeter of water, and further being generally insoluble in acid. |
